Wormer et al v. Lowe
Plaintiff: Geoffrey Wormer, Scott Reynolds and Jeff Cochran
Defendant: Daniel H Lowe
Case Number: 1:2023cv01842
Filed: July 20, 2023
Court: U.S. District Court for the District of Colorado
Presiding Judge: Susan B Prose
Referring Judge: Susan Prose
Nature of Suit: Contract: Recovery/Enforcement
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1332 Diversity-Contract Default
Jury Demanded By: None
